Eberechi Eze has reportedly enjoyed a strong week as Arsenal’s latest squad addition, and the English midfielder is now pushing for a starting role in the highly anticipated weekend clash against Liverpool. Both clubs are direct contenders for the league title this season, having opened their campaigns with back-to-back victories. This encounter promises to be one of the defining fixtures in the early stages of the competition.
Arsenal’s Ambition and Liverpool’s Defensive Concerns
Arsenal will arrive at Anfield with confidence, buoyed by a successful summer of recruitment and preparation. The team from the Emirates will be eager to demonstrate the progress they have made and to prove that they are now more formidable than in previous seasons. Liverpool, meanwhile, is dealing with concerns at the back. Their defensive performances have been questioned, and Arsenal will likely aim to exploit any weaknesses they can identify.
Despite these vulnerabilities, Liverpool remains a difficult opponent, especially at home, and will be determined not to let their rivals leave with all three points. Both sides may need an individual moment of brilliance to settle the game, and the question is whether Eze can deliver such an impact for Arsenal.

Eze’s Potential Role in the Line-up
According to The Sun, Eze has impressed in recent training sessions, leaving manager Mikel Arteta with a positive impression. The report notes that the Arsenal boss is now seriously considering starting him in the match against Liverpool. With Bukayo Saka confirmed absent and Martin Odegaard facing doubts over his fitness, the possibility of Eze featuring from the beginning has increased significantly.
Eze has already been involved in competitive action this season, including appearances since the Community Shield, which suggests he is physically ready for such a demanding fixture. His creativity, composure on the ball, and attacking instinct could offer Arsenal a valuable option in what is expected to be a tightly contested encounter.
As both teams seek an early advantage in the title race, Arsenal will be looking for players capable of stepping up in crucial moments. Eze now has the opportunity to show he can be that decisive influence, and all eyes will be on whether he can seize the moment at Anfield.
